RW-As per "Y&O"- that is Robyn's daughter Maisie singing. Apparently (as far as I know) some of the songs that ended up on Y&O were actually recorded over old tapes of Childe Maisie (she's 21 now) singing and there is some sonic bleed-through. I got the chance to hang out with Robyn after his show Friday night and asked him what he thought about this site, and unfortunately, he has not seen it.He did ask me to pass a couple of messages along, though. To the people who have set up a Web site dedicated to Figgy, the cat that graces the inside of Moss Elixir. He is the not the cat's true father. He is only the step-father. Michele already had the cat when they got together. He also wanted to pass along that Michele has only one L. Other than that, he is getting ready for the filming that will take place at the end of the tour in New York. Jonathan Demme will be directing, and there's the possibility that up to four shows will be recorded and edited into the final film, which should be out in the first quater of next year. At this point, Robyn and Warner Bros. are working out what will be included in the set and what will appear on the soundtrack. He is playing a couple of new songs that may be performed for the film. He also said there is some talk that he may be back in the States in the spring for some more dates.
